According to a recent report by trusted PH based technology website, there will be a new smartphone brand to arrive in our country. It's the Obi Worldphone which is managed by the ex Apple CEO, John Sculley. First they will bring here two new affordable smartphones, the SF1 and SJ1.5.

The SF1

The Obi Worldphone SF1 is a midrange smartphone that comes with 5 inch FHD screen, fiberglass unibody frame, 1.5 GHz 64 bit Snapdragon 615 octa core processor, 2 / 3 GB of RAM, 16 / 32 GB of expandable internal storage, 3,000 mAh of battery and LTE connectivity. It also has a 13 MP rear camera and 5 MP selfie cam with flash.

The SJ1.5

Next is the Obi Worldphone SJ1.5, which is a lower end model that comes with a 5 Inch HD screen, polycarbonate body, 1.3 GHz MediaTek quad core processor, 1 GB RAM, 16 GB expandable internal storage, 8 MP rear camera w/ LED flash powered by an Omnivision sensor, 5 MP selfie camera and 3,000 mAh of battery.

Both models comes with a custom Lifespeed UI in Android 5.0.2 Lollipop OS for the SF1 and Android 5.1 Lollipop OS with the SJ1.5. The SF1 is priced at USD 199 (2 GB RAM / 16 GB ROM) and USD 299 (3 GB RAM / 32 GB ROM) model. The SJ1.5 is priced at USD 129. Given those pricings, the Obi Worldphones that will be available here comes with competitive prices even against the local branded phones. They'll arrive here by December according to the company.

Both handsets are priced internationally at $199 and $299 for the SF1’s 2GB/3GB variant, respectively, with the SJ1.5 asking for $129. Although, according to the company, they will be available here in the Philippines before December 2015 for under Php10K.
